Today's devotion is based on Acts 2:42: “And they devoted themselves to the apostles’ teaching and the fellowship, the breaking of bread and the prayers.” This verse gives us a description of the first congregation and, at the same time, a description of the Christian Church throughout time, for these practices will always exist and can never change in a Christian congregation. A true Christian church follows the teachings of the New Testament, that is the teaching of the Apostles. A true Christian church comes together in fellowship, both in everyday life and the worship Service. A true Christian church celebrates the Lord’s Supper. A true Christian church spends time earnest, meaningful prayer, especially in the worship service where public prayer is prayed. So, while worship styles have changed over the years, these things cannot change; teaching of God’s Word, coming together in worship, celebrating the Lord’s Supper, and purposeful prayer.
